Heat pumps are designed to manage temperature making use of electricity to move existing heat instead of generating it themselves. But in order to function efficiently, a heat pump needs to be the best size. Getting it wrong can lead to poor performance and boosted power expenses. An undersized heatpump struggles to stay on par with cooling down demands, while an extra-large one wastes power by short-cycling and wearing faster than it should.

Various other elements that influence heat pump sizing include the home's square video footage and format. For example, homes with higher ceilings call for bigger heatpump given that hot air surges. Also, older homes with ductwork that mishandles or full of leakages may require to utilize a bigger heatpump than newer ones.

The very best way to identify the optimal heatpump dimension for your home is by doing a Hand-operated J computation. This industry-standard estimation takes into account your home's square video, ceiling elevations, insulation quality, variety of doors and windows, local environment, and extra.
